Emissions on agricultural land — Emissions (CO2eq) from N2O in Germany
Germany: Emissions on agricultural land — Emissions (CO2eq) from N2O was 22,572 kt in 2023. ▼ Falling
Emissions on agricultural land — Emissions (CO2eq) from N2O in Germany, 1990–2023
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in kt.
Analysis
In 2023, emissions on agricultural land — emissions (co2eq) from n2o in Germany stood at 22,572 kt.
The figure is up 3.8% on the previous year and down 18.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, emissions on agricultural land — emissions (co2eq) from n2o in Germany peaked at 32,144 kt in 1990 and was at its lowest, 21,752 kt, in 2022.
That places Germany 21st out of 222 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 34 years of available data.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
